    SDAC 24 Early Drag Racing

    I think this has been asked in other venues, but not sure what exactly came of it. The drag strip that we will be using for SDAC has an event called "Real Street Drags" on Friday night. Basically it's a clocks off race where you can spot cars out, have flash light starts, instant green, normal tree, basically anything goes. Of course they also just have normal just test and tune lanes also. No matter how you start, you'll still get time slips, just no times are shown on the board, just win lights.

    Would anyone be interested in going? I think it would be a blast to invade RSD with some of our turbo dodges. Most people there know my van, and I've heard people say it runs 10's so not many people want to race, or if they do they want spots, but some of the unknown guys could possibly make some money.

    I'm pretty sure that JohnnyIroc and myself will be there to put down a couple test passes, and I doubt it would take much arm twisting to get Jaren to bring the daytona out. The more TD'ers that show the more fun it is. I think admission will be either $35 or $40 to race or $15 to spectate.
